(1.) 使用系統自帶的time工具查看 (2.)使用top命令 (3.)GODEBUG和gctrace 執行程序之前,添加環境變量GODEBUG='gctrace=1'來跟蹤垃圾回收信息。 (4.) 利用runtime.ReadMemStats()方法 (5.)使用 ...
. 介紹 對於生產環境中運行的進程,可以用 Go 內置的性能分析工具 pprof 窺測進程的當前狀況。 Profiling Go Programs 很好地演示了用 pprof 找到性能瓶頸的過程,這里只演示簡單用法。 . 啟用實時的pprof . 啟用實時的 pprof 非常簡單,只需要引入 net http pprof ,然后啟動 http server 就可以了: 直接用瀏覽器打開 http ...
2020-02-07 11:50 0 1842 推薦指數:
(1.) 使用系統自帶的time工具查看 (2.)使用top命令 (3.)GODEBUG和gctrace 執行程序之前,添加環境變量GODEBUG='gctrace=1'來跟蹤垃圾回收信息。 (4.) 利用runtime.ReadMemStats()方法 (5.)使用 ...
程序開頭 profile on 結尾 profile viewer 然后就會很貼心滴出現下面的界面,可以從中展開,查看每段運行的時間 ...
...
以下命令都可以查看出系統運行時間。對於查看機器的狀態很有幫助。 w -b 查看最后一次系統啟動的時間 w -r 查看當前系統運行時間 last reboot 查看系統歷史啟動的時間 top up后表示系統到目前運行了多久時間 w up后表示系統到目前運行了多久時間 uptime up后 ...
今日思語:要想生活過得去,常給生活加點綠 有時想知道JVM的參數是否開啟或者設置的默認值是多少時,可以有如下方式 1、使用java -XX:+PrintFlagsFinal 該命令用於查看最終值,初始值可能被修改掉(查看初始值可以使用java -XX ...
使用ps命令可以查看進程的運行時間 ps 命令的 etime 和 etimes 格式化選項指定了正在運行的進程的啟動時間,其中 etime 顯示了自從該進程啟動以來,經歷過的時間,格式為 [[DD-]hh:]mm:ss。 etimes 顯示了自該進程啟動以來,經歷過的時間,以秒的形式 ...
1、-XX:+PrintFlagsInitial 其中,=表示默認值,:=表示被用戶或者JVM修改后的值 可以用以下命令將其寫入文件中查看 2、-XX:+PrintFlagsFinal 3、-XX:+UnlockExperimentalVMOptions解鎖實驗參數 4、-XX ...